What You Should Know

Green Giant Steamers Green Beans & Almonds is a shelf-stable frozen side that lives in the frozen vegetables section, usually stacked near other microwaveable steam-in-bag veggies, frozen green beans, and mixed vegetable pouches. Packaged in an easy-to-stack box with a microwaveable pouch inside, it reads as a quick, no-fuss addition to weeknight dinners, holiday plates, or simple meal-prep routines. The product suits shoppers looking for a vegetable side that feels a bit elevated — green beans tossed with roasted almonds — without the work of chopping or toasting nuts. Green Giant positions this as a family-friendly, reassuringly familiar brand: a legacy, value-oriented company appealing to busy parents, single adults who cook for one, and older consumers seeking convenience and predictable quality. The label leans on a “Simply Steam”/no added sauce message and lists short, recognizable ingredients, creating a natural and wholesome health halo; there’s no organic or kid-focused gimmickry, just straightforward imagery and preparation claims. In processing context, these are blanched and frozen green beans with roasted almonds, salt and a small amount of baking agent and oil — a lightly processed frozen vegetable product. Sensory notes: expect crisp-tender, slightly snappy green beans with the toasted, crunchy bite of almonds and a subtle savory saltiness; warming in the pouch creates a quick little ritual of slit-and-pour convenience. Use it as a practical weeknight side, a holiday plate filler, or a component in composed bowls — familiar, convenient, and decidedly American in its supermarket placement and everyday hospitality role.

Ultra-Processing Assessment

NOVA Score:3 / 4

Processed Food

Why this score?

Contains mostly whole vegetables and nuts but includes added salt, roasted almonds with added oil, and processing steps (blanching, freezing, ready-to-heat), placing it in the processed foods (NOVA 3) category rather than unprocessed or ultra-processed.
